Transaction 98efd391b0122aae77482e6e9752cc4f90d8805fa4b5b68c1c2de5a46be2623c

1 Input
2 Outputs
  • 98efd391b0122aae77482e6e9752cc4f90d8805fa4b5b68c1c2de5a46be2623c:0
  • value  17000000
    address  3FjHx3ffpPxbVRxtEaJpmJsTYrP1sXZdn7
  • 98efd391b0122aae77482e6e9752cc4f90d8805fa4b5b68c1c2de5a46be2623c:1
  • value  20988609
    address  1Hyt5pWLiL2ypWy3QEm48niQutaWcuHTLU